Vacancy | Site Assistant
Title: Site Assistant
Hours: 39 hours per week, 52 weeks per annum
Salary: Up to £23,264
Organisation: Chelmsford College
Closing Date: 20/04/2025
The College is seeking a highly motivated Site Assistant to work within the existing Estates Team.
The successful candidate will work as a member of the Estates team reporting directly to the Estates and Sustainability Manager ensuring all job tickets are completed within set timescales to ensure that the premises are kept clean, tidy and risk free.
This position is 39 hours per week, working Monday to Friday, 52 weeks of the year, working on a shift pattern; however, there will be a requirement to cover evening sessions and start time may vary to accommodate this.
The College is committed to equality and diversity and to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young people. We expect all staff to share these commitments.
This post is subject to an Enhanced DBS Disclosure. Starting salary will be dependent on qualifications, skills and experience.
